Nordic skiing training equipment replicates the physical demands of cross-country skiing without requiring snow or extensive outdoor space. These devices typically employ resistance mechanisms, such as flywheels, fans, or magnetic brakes, to simulate the effort of propelling oneself across varying terrains. Some models also incorporate arm movements to engage the upper body, mirroring the poling action integral to the sport. Advanced versions may offer interactive features like adjustable resistance levels and programmed workouts tailored to individual fitness goals.

Indoor training solutions offer consistent, accessible exercise opportunities regardless of weather or location. This equipment strengthens key muscle groups used in cross-country skiing, improving cardiovascular health and endurance. The low-impact nature of these exercises makes them suitable for individuals seeking to minimize stress on joints. Originally developed to facilitate off-season training for competitive skiers, these machines have become increasingly popular among fitness enthusiasts of all levels seeking a full-body, low-impact workout.

Suitable fibers for powered knitting equipment encompass a range of animal and plant-based materials, with varying properties influencing the finished product. A key example is a natural, protein-based fiber derived from sheep, prized for its warmth, elasticity, and ability to absorb dyes. This type of fiber offers a wide range of weights and textures, from fine merino to chunky Icelandic varieties, making it adaptable for diverse projects.

The appropriateness of a specific fiber for mechanical knitting relates to its strength, elasticity, and how it interacts with the machine’s mechanisms. Durable fibers that resist breaking under tension produce consistent stitches and reduce the likelihood of malfunctions. Elasticity allows the fabric to retain its shape after knitting, while appropriate fiber preparation minimizes snagging or tangling during the automated process. Historically, the transition to powered knitting expanded the range of fiber types suitable for larger-scale production, leading to innovation in yarn spinning and fabric construction techniques. This development significantly impacted textile production, making knitted goods more accessible and affordable.

This device utilizes a system of punching rectangular holes along the spine of a document and then using metal hoops, often referred to as “double-loop wire” or “wire-o,” to bind the pages together. A common example is the binding frequently found in calendars, notebooks, and reports.

This binding method offers a professional and durable finish, allowing documents to lay flat for easy reading and note-taking. Its clean appearance and the ability to easily turn pages make it a popular choice for presentations and reports. Developed as an alternative to more cumbersome methods, this technology streamlined the process of document binding, enabling quicker and more efficient production. This has contributed to its widespread use across various industries, from education and business to print finishing and personal organization.
